Oil Pump: Service and Repair




Oil Pump Replacement

Removal Procedure

1. Remove the engine covers. Refer to Engine Cover Replacement (Service and Repair).
2. Remove the spark plugs in order to ease crankshaft/engine rotation. Refer to Spark Plug Replacement (Service and Repair).
3. Remove the engine front cover. Refer to Engine Front Cover Replacement (Service and Repair).

Important: DO NOT remove the left bank idler sprocket.


4. Remove the primary timing chain. Refer to Primary Camshaft Intermediate Drive Chain Removal (Overhaul).
5. Remove the crankshaft sprocket. Refer to Crankshaft Sprocket Removal (Overhaul).
6. Remove the oil pump bolts and the oil pump. Refer to Oil Pump Removal (Overhaul).
7. Perform the following steps as necessary:

* Disassemble the oil pump. Refer to Oil Pump Disassemble (Overhaul).
* Clean and inspect the oil pump. Refer to Oil Pump Disassemble (Overhaul).

Installation Procedure

1. Assemble the oil pump as necessary. Refer to Oil Pump Assemble (Overhaul).
2. Install the oil pump. Refer to Oil Pump Installation (Overhaul).
3. Install the crankshaft sprocket. Refer to Crankshaft Sprocket Installation (Overhaul).
4. Install the primary timing chain. Refer to Primary Camshaft Intermediate Drive Chain Installation (Overhaul).
5. Install the spark plugs. Refer to Spark Plug Replacement (Service and Repair).
6. Install the engine front cover. Refer to Engine Front Cover Replacement (Service and Repair).
7. Install the engine covers. Refer to Engine Cover Replacement (Service and Repair).
